Palm Springs, California

Palm Springs made itself a getaway for famous people in large part because of its proximity to Los Angeles. The town and its many golf courses are just about 100 miles east of the studios in LA. Unless one of the popular desert music festivals is raging, the Palm Springs area in the Coachella Valley has a rather sleepy feel to it. Although it may be too hot in the summer, the rest of the year is a great time to find a vacation rental and soak in the pool (a feature that basically comes standard in the desert).

Bing Crosby’s Former Home

A slightly less ostentatious option — and our choice of favorite celebrity home in Palm Springs — is this home which once belonged to the crooner Bing Crosby. Built in the early 30s, the home reflects a common hacienda style that was once common in Southern California. The vaulted wooden ceiling, tile roof, and brick floors reflect an elegant yet functional design (these features don’t trap heat), while the back pool deck is the home’s best feature and complete with a cantina.

Frank Sinatra Estate

Likely the biggest name to call the California desert home is Frank Sinatra. His estate looks much like it did when he lived there, but we prefer Bing’s place because of the price tag — those that want to stay in Frankie’s home need to be ready to spend $2,500 – $4,500 USD per night.

The Real World House

Once upon a time, The Real World revolutionized the reality TV game and was one of the most popular shows in the world. It was set on the premise that strangers were constantly filmed living together in a very nice house. One of the more memorable seasons happened in 2006 in Key West. The bright, waterfront home is now available for rent and can accommodate up to 22 people and their reality TV-worthy shenanigans.

Bougainvillea House Villa

This unbelievably beautiful home is located on a less-frequented island in the Bahamas, which makes it a perfect choice for privacy. Celebrities like Penelope Cruz and her husband Javier Bardem, as well as Glenn Close, and Maury Povich have all made use of this home. Also, in 2016, it was used for the cover shoot for the famous (or infamous) Sports Illustrated Swimsuit Issue.

For a Jamaican alternative, this home was lived in by Sean Connery and has 50 acres of private land surrounding it. To think of the things 007 may have done in there…

New Mexico

We guess this qualifies as our surprise pick! New Mexico, in general, is often overlooked as a vacation destination (or as a quality state in general). While its biggest claim to Hollywood fame may be Breaking Bad, the showe depicted Albuquerque more like a hellish landscape than a cool place to be.

However, New Mexico’s capital, Santa Fe, is incredibly charming and remains somewhat of a hidden gem simply because it’s located in New Mexico. Big time names like Robert Redford, Georgia O’Keeffe, and Shirley McClaine have all called the Land of Enchantment home. That said, this is truly the place to visit for literary buffs. Cormac McCarthy lived in Santa Fe and used the surrounding area as inspiration for his “Border Trilogy” which included Blood Meridian and All the Pretty Horses. Not to mention, Game of Thrones author George RR Martin lives here and is a major contributor to the city’s art scene.

Literary Cabin

In keeping with the literary theme, this cabin rental sits on a larger eco-lodge property and was once the home of Aldous Huxley, author of Brave New World. While it may not be as luxurious as the others, it is just as historic. The rental is near the town of Taos and the famous UNESCO site Taos Pueblo.

Houdini’s House

There have been many houses in Los Angeles that were once owned by celebrities and later used as vacation rentals. This includes big names like Denzel Washington and Jim Morrison. Although, the most popular celebrity vacation rental in LA was once owned by the world’s most famous magician. Houdini’s house is one of the most best-known homes in the area, along with the Playboy Mansion and the Fresh Prince of Bell Air house, and is an amazing example of Hollywood elegance. With massive grounds, ornate living quarters, and parking for over 80 cars, it is a truly unique, authentically Hollywood place to stay.

An alternative would be to stay at this Hollywood estate that has been owned by David Bowie, Orson Welles, Barbra Streisand, and Frank Sinatra.
